Gurney E. Smith Jr., 80, of 1321 Wooster Road, Winona Lake, died at 11:01 a.m. Jan. 19, 2008, in his residence.

He was born Nov. 10, 1927, at home in Valley View, Pa., the eighth of nine children, to Gurney E. Sr. and Mabel Bossler. On April 6, 1941, he married Marilyn Maria Weinreich, who died April 11, 2005.

He was an auto mechanic at Bresslers Auto Service, Hegins, Pa., for many years, and was a small engine specialist. Moving to Warsaw in 1975, he worked in a small engine shop and later at Brethren Herald Print Shop. He attended Tri Valley High School, Hegins. A resident of Kosciusko County since 1976, he was a member of the Antique Tool Collectors Society and loved to restore and repair antique clocks. He was a member of Warsaw Community Bible Church and was a respected representative of the Lord. He enlisted in the U.S. Coast Guard in 1946, serving two years as 1st Class Seaman serving in World War II.
